背景技术Background technique

现在市面上的用于患者行走康复训练和老人辅助行走的框架式助行器主要分为三类:四脚无轮型、四脚有轮型和两脚有轮型。这三类助行器的优缺点如下:The frame-type walkers currently on the market for patient walking rehabilitation training and assisted walking for the elderly are mainly divided into three categories: four-legged wheelless type, four-legged wheeled type and two-legged wheeled type. The advantages and disadvantages of these three types of walkers are as follows:

四脚无轮型的助行器由于支脚与地面的阻力较大,不容易打滑,患者在扶着行走时不容易滑倒,稳定性好,但是这种助行器在使用时需要患者将其提起来才能将其往前移动,考虑到助行器的使用者绝大部分是下肢无力的病人或老人,所以这样的移动方式太过费力而且具有一定的安全隐患;The four-legged wheelless walker is not easy to slip due to the large resistance between the feet and the ground, and the patient is not easy to slip when walking with support, and the stability is good, but this kind of walker requires the patient to hold it It can only be moved forward by lifting it up. Considering that most of the users of the walker are patients or the elderly with weak lower limbs, this way of moving is too laborious and has certain safety hazards;

四脚有轮型的助行器虽然使患者使用起来更加省力,但是由于助行器与地面之间的摩擦力很小,导致患者扶住助行器向前移步特别是上坡或者下坡时,一旦身体向前或向后倾斜,则会打滑摔跤;Although the four-legged wheeled walker makes it easier for patients to use it, because the friction between the walker and the ground is very small, the patient will hold the walker to move forward, especially uphill or downhill. , once the body leans forward or backward, it will slip and wrestle;

两脚有轮型助行器虽然一定程度上弥补了前面两种助行器的缺点,但是从另一个角度来说,也削弱了前面两种助行器的优点,也就是说,两脚有轮型的助行器的稳定性不如四脚无轮型助行器,灵活性不如四脚有轮型助行器。Although the two-legged wheeled walker makes up for the shortcomings of the previous two walkers to a certain extent, it also weakens the advantages of the previous two walkers from another perspective, that is to say, the two-legged walker Wheel-type walkers are not as stable as four-legged wheelless walkers, and less flexible than four-legged wheeled walkers.

本实施例全方位脚轮助行器的工作过程如下:The working process of the all-round caster walker of this embodiment is as follows:

本实施例的全方位脚轮助行器100中,患者双手扶住第一支撑架101和第二支撑架102向下按压移步时,辅助行走轮505通过弹簧502缩回套管501内,使套管501着地,形成一个四角无轮型的助行器。当患者保持站立姿势而向前推动助行器时,施加在助行器上的纵向力减小,辅助行走轮505通过弹簧502伸出套管501,形成一个四脚有轮型的助行器。坐垫9平放时助行器可作为椅子使用,在用于行走时,可将其折叠放置。In the all-round caster walker 100 of this embodiment, when the patient holds the first support frame 101 and the second support frame 102 with both hands and presses down to move, the auxiliary walking wheel 505 is retracted into the casing 501 by the spring 502, so that The casing 501 is grounded, forming a four-corner wheelless walking aid. When the patient maintains a standing posture and pushes the walker forward, the longitudinal force exerted on the walker decreases, and the auxiliary walking wheel 505 extends out of the sleeve 501 through the spring 502 to form a four-legged wheeled walker . The walker can be used as a chair when the cushion 9 is laid flat, and it can be folded and placed when being used for walking.
